I installed Office 2003 on a computer, as I have done a zillion times. I setup outlook to get pop3 mail. When I click send/receive - it says sending - complete, receiving - complete, but it does not actually get any of the mail. I tried with outlook express and it works as expected, when I send a test message to the account and then click send/receive, it gets the mail.

I saw online to move mapi32.dll and let it get recreated. That didn't help. I also deleted the profile through control panel -> mail and then opened outlook, created a new profile and added the account again, but still no mail and no error.

Anyone have any other thoughts?
